Overall my experience did not meet the expectations I had and the service I have received before. I dropped my car off late morning on Monday June 11 due to multiple malfunctions after a trip home from Illinois. (no cruise control, wrench light, check engine light, etc..) I also mentioned that my sync was acting up and the "Would you like to run a vechile health report" continued to come on. I wanted to get everything set up and working before my warranty runs out. On Monday evening I received a call stating technicians couldn't find anything wrong with the car. I asked them to drive it over 60 miles per hour. The next day I called back and was told they drove the car to Raymore and did find the problems. A part was to be ordered and the car would be worked on. On Thursday I had stopped by to retrieve personal items from my car that I had needed. I was told I needed to bring my original key back in order to complete the process of fixing my car. No one had called to tell me that prior to me stopping by, but we arranged I would bring it when the car was ready and would wait while the technician used the original key to reset the automobile. On Thursday evening I received a call that the car was ready and was asked to pick it up early Friday morning. I came at 9:00 a.m. to pick up my car and was told the technician found something else wrong with it. I was FINALLY offered a rental car after being without a car for 5 days. I was told I would not be responsible for the payment for the rental car and would just need to return it with 3/4 tank of gas. On Saturday, I got another call that now my car was ready. I came back to pick it up around 1:00 p.m. When I got there, my car had not been cleaned and I was asked if I wanted to wait for them to do it. I didn't want to wait anymore than I had already waited. It was disappointing that after having my car for 6 days that it didn't get washed prior to my picking it up. I also noticed that over 200 miles had been put on my car and I had NO gas. I understand needing to drive it to find the problems but I feel like my gas should have been filled and my car should've been clean. I drove my car 5 miles and the "would you like to run a vechicle health report" came on. My sync is also not hooked up. I noticed today that my charge card was charged $25.00. I was expected a much better experience like I have received in the past and am unsure what to do. More
